Essential Duties & Responsibilities · Pricing Strategy & Support o Partner with Global Product Manager and Finance to execute pricing strategies, including list price setting, customer discount policies, and annual reviews of price lists and contracts. o Monitor competitor pricing, market dynamics, and raw material cost trends; recommend updates to ensure pricing aligns with company goals. o Support the development and maintenance of pricing tools that Sales can use to quote effectively. o Analyze margin performance and assist with scenario modeling for proposed pricing changes. o Help communicate and implement pricing updates across Sales, Finance, and Operations. · Product Management Development o Collaborate with Global Product Manager to learn how product line strategies are developed; participate in analyzing risks, opportunities, and market dynamics. o Contribute to business case preparation by gathering market and financial data. o Support New Product Development (NPD) projects through requirements documentation, cross-functional coordination, and milestone tracking. o Assist in go-to-market planning by preparing product messaging, sales tools, and launch collateral with Marketing and Sales. o Monitor post-launch performance and provide input into corrective actions or improvements. o Work with Sales, Operations, and Engineering to provide product support and resolve escalations. o Lead small-scale product or process improvement initiatives to gain project ownership experience. Candidate Profile This opportunity is designed for employees who: · Are excelling in their current role (e.g., Sales, Operations, Engineering, Marketing, or Finance) and want to gain broader exposure. · Want to develop commercial acumen, especially in pricing, as part of their preparation for larger organizational leadership roles. · Have an interest in learning how products are managed across their lifecycle, from idea to launch to sustaining revenue. · Are motivated to collaborate cross-functionally and strengthen their influence and problem-solving skills.
